"agamia" meaning in Polish

See agamia in All languages combined, or Wiktionary

Noun

IPA: /aˈɡa.mja/ Forms: no-table-tags [table-tags], agamia [nominative, singular], agamii [genitive, singular], agamii [dative, singular], agamię [accusative, singular], agamią [instrumental, singular], agamii [locative, singular], agamio [singular, vocative]
Rhymes: -amja Etymology: Borrowed from Greek αγαμία (agamía). By surface analysis, a- + -gamia. First attested in 1836.   1. (literary) agamy (state of being unmarried) Tags: feminine, literary Synonyms: bezżeństwo

  2. (biology) agamy (inability to sexually reproduce) (as seen in worker bees or ants) Tags: feminine
